Package: mozilla-thunderbird
Version: 1.0.6, 1.0.7
Description: When filter logging is turned on, it generates a file
called filterlog.html in the mail directory. Each applied filter
generates a dated entry in this file. Unfortunately, the date on the
entry is uniformly "1969-12-31 19:00:00". The time on my Debian testing
box is correct, but it appears some variable in this routine was never
set or reset. Actual time is ignored.
